summ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Daniel Drake <dsd@gentoo.org>2007-02-08 15:00:09 +0000
committerDaniel Drake <dsd@gentoo.org>2007-02-08 15:00:09 +0000
commitec5ddd5e42ddb6ac3b08d2344d49376a16640ea8 (patch)
tree32621a83bcc1df72ac25bcb6d40ae0ed498ab5de /dev-util/acgmake
parentstable 1.8.3 (diff)
downloadhistorical-ec5ddd5e42ddb6ac3b08d2344d49376a16640ea8.tar.gz
historical-ec5ddd5e42ddb6ac3b08d2344d49376a16640ea8.tar.bz2
historical-ec5ddd5e42ddb6ac3b08d2344d49376a16640ea8.zip
Fix propogation of CFLAGS from ebuild level during build
Package-Manager: portage-2.1.2-r9
Diffstat (limited to 'dev-util/acgmake')
-rw-r--r--dev-util/acgmake/ChangeLog9
-rw-r--r--dev-util/acgmake/Manifest15
-rw-r--r--dev-util/acgmake/acgmake-1.2-r2.ebuild40
-rw-r--r--dev-util/acgmake/files/digest-acgmake-1.2-r23
4 files changed, 61 insertions, 6 deletions
diff --git a/dev-util/acgmake/ChangeLog b/dev-util/acgmake/ChangeLog
index 1c8416cc6aca..ad746bf4ed46 100644
--- a/dev-util/acgmake/ChangeLog
+++ b/dev-util/acgmake/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for dev-util/acgmake
-#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-util/acgmake/ChangeLog,v 1.3 2006/11/23 19:01:59 blubb Exp $
+#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-util/acgmake/ChangeLog,v 1.4 2007/02/08 15:00:09 dsd Exp $
+
+*acgmake-1.2-r2 (08 Feb 2007)
+
+ 08 Feb 2007; Daniel Drake <dsd@gentoo.org> +acgmake-1.2-r2.ebuild:
+ Fix propogation of CFLAGS from ebuild level during build
23 Nov 2006; <blubb@gentoo.org> acgmake-1.2-r1.ebuild:
stable on amd64
diff --git a/dev-util/acgmake/Manifest b/dev-util/acgmake/Manifest
index 90bceb1427b5..d19c49c8406d 100644
--- a/dev-util/acgmake/Manifest
+++ b/dev-util/acgmake/Manifest
@@ -3,10 +3,14 @@ EBUILD acgmake-1.2-r1.ebuild 918 RMD160 e94626d6eac2f4e9d5c1e78dea0b2530fec7cd70
MD5 2c433a543c018b949bcc870778876caf acgmake-1.2-r1.ebuild 918
RMD160 e94626d6eac2f4e9d5c1e78dea0b2530fec7cd70 acgmake-1.2-r1.ebuild 918
SHA256 6d70e8dbb573c2e72a5e33786e553138e4488cac49f14f9ae2be80578b950d61 acgmake-1.2-r1.ebuild 918
-MISC ChangeLog 597 RMD160 c97b616f5939f49e8e726f0e44267852699b947e SHA1 3987a9674ce6f89e3214a13074105fe9d03d7d4f SHA256 f3680e0692c533f4e8c3a8c562e0fa2adb1c8ab0ce66cbb4f672109de800194e
-MD5 f9d4cc6aa0a0cd9ccb05f34690be6dfe ChangeLog 597
-RMD160 c97b616f5939f49e8e726f0e44267852699b947e ChangeLog 597
-SHA256 f3680e0692c533f4e8c3a8c562e0fa2adb1c8ab0ce66cbb4f672109de800194e ChangeLog 597
+EBUILD acgmake-1.2-r2.ebuild 1007 RMD160 d4417d9e6d83d6e338077572cdeacdb2e3e9e460 SHA1 6033f90bddbe9d7c2dcf214908ea2512bf5af2f4 SHA256 c623b5d241ac4f26dfb80b895ccadfb20d1bbde0a11b8de133034af91bfff530
+MD5 657ccbc7bce3474d6f20863e40920d61 acgmake-1.2-r2.ebuild 1007
+RMD160 d4417d9e6d83d6e338077572cdeacdb2e3e9e460 acgmake-1.2-r2.ebuild 1007
+SHA256 c623b5d241ac4f26dfb80b895ccadfb20d1bbde0a11b8de133034af91bfff530 acgmake-1.2-r2.ebuild 1007
+MISC ChangeLog 755 RMD160 7f5a09bb8f6b8649765a3f0ce643f0b46ff886c1 SHA1 9c655cf7f0d03734e9793552856beb5145d35b83 SHA256 8276a3a691bec4dddb61a3c67bfdf02ae8dcb89d0ccbe8f731180925a33a84a4
+MD5 6ffe4e7ad4c22023d0dc7865b2e48ca8 ChangeLog 755
+RMD160 7f5a09bb8f6b8649765a3f0ce643f0b46ff886c1 ChangeLog 755
+SHA256 8276a3a691bec4dddb61a3c67bfdf02ae8dcb89d0ccbe8f731180925a33a84a4 ChangeLog 755
MISC metadata.xml 455 RMD160 051d304b581d9700f8b50e7c021b64bc651de0b8 SHA1 e077b0d9e3e49d05df7d3adf7b2cbe8b8839addf SHA256 1764eeb5c09036331497b2233550c848a3ea26c2ab6669b2f49da6c8d7b8c1b1
MD5 f457add18e4cadd2e98e267544076998 metadata.xml 455
RMD160 051d304b581d9700f8b50e7c021b64bc651de0b8 metadata.xml 455
@@ -14,3 +18,6 @@ SHA256 1764eeb5c09036331497b2233550c848a3ea26c2ab6669b2f49da6c8d7b8c1b1 metadata
MD5 34b13794227482ef3c78171df77d9444 files/digest-acgmake-1.2-r1 223
RMD160 72fa2bb5e747d8531d0679bcaae114dc5a623137 files/digest-acgmake-1.2-r1 223
SHA256 134485b89f763a797c9da39be68bc472acae5b1798ffb50ec15fbd9cd87f9ca5 files/digest-acgmake-1.2-r1 223
+MD5 34b13794227482ef3c78171df77d9444 files/digest-acgmake-1.2-r2 223
+RMD160 72fa2bb5e747d8531d0679bcaae114dc5a623137 files/digest-acgmake-1.2-r2 223
+SHA256 134485b89f763a797c9da39be68bc472acae5b1798ffb50ec15fbd9cd87f9ca5 files/digest-acgmake-1.2-r2 223
diff --git a/dev-util/acgmake/acgmake-1.2-r2.ebuild b/dev-util/acgmake/acgmake-1.2-r2.ebuild
new file mode 100644
index 000000000000..1be5c8866156
--- /dev/null
+++ b/dev-util/acgmake/acgmake-1.2-r2.ebuild
@@ -0,0 +1,40 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-util/acgmake/acgmake-1.2-r2.ebuild,v 1.1 2007/02/08 15:00:09 dsd Exp $
+
+inherit eutils
+
+S=${WORKDIR}/${PN}
+DESCRIPTION="Build system for large projects"
+HOMEPAGE="http://www-i8.informatik.rwth-aachen.de/software/acgmake/html/index.html"
+SRC_URI="http://www-i8.informatik.rwth-aachen.de/software/acgmake/${P}.tgz"
+
+LICENSE="LGP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+DEPEND="app-shells/bash
+ sys-devel/make"
+
+src_unpack() {
+ unpack ${A}
+ cd ${S}
+
+ find . -name 'CVS' -type d -print0 | xargs -0 rm -rf
+ sed -i "s:g++.*:g++:" configs/config.gcc-linux
+ chmod 644 ${S}/configs/*
+ chmod 644 ${S}/modules/*
+
+ # Allow ebuilds to set CXXFLAGS
+ epatch ${FILESDIR}/${P}-cflags.patch
+}
+
+src_install() {
+ insinto /usr/lib/misc/acgmake
+ doins Config Rules
+ cp -a bin configs modules ${D}/usr/lib/misc/acgmake
+
+ dosym ../lib/misc/acgmake/bin/acgmake /usr/bin/acgmake
+}
+
diff --git a/dev-util/acgmake/files/digest-acgmake-1.2-r2 b/dev-util/acgmake/files/digest-acgmake-1.2-r2
new file mode 100644
index 000000000000..869e3e35e62d
--- /dev/null
+++ b/dev-util/acgmake/files/digest-acgmake-1.2-r2
@@ -0,0 +1,3 @@
+MD5 4ad554d1c5694cafb52c71c5dd8d4df5 acgmake-1.2.tgz 60894
+RMD160 3803fe5694451b6da5111e20e71fad6e377eeeb7 acgmake-1.2.tgz 60894
+SHA256 6da22b8cc63c24ada430ca3120357cff774f1348f11d892956dba49cc9d680e8 acgmake-1.2.tgz 60894